I went to an estate sale once that was loaded with old sporting goods from a guy who must have been 90 and never threw anything away.
One Item I really liked were the hunting pants which looked exactly like what that guy is wearing.
They were tan colored, high waisted and reminded me of cavalry breeches but heavier material.
I bought a lot of vintage hunting clothes at that sale including a red and black checkered Mackinaw jacket.
It all fit me and I probably should have saved the stuff but ended up wearing it until it was completely worn out.
